Well I received the exhaust today. Pretty amazing how fast it came.
Frankly, I was expecting some pretty low build quality for the price, but I was pleasantly surprised. I've posted a few pictures.
All the welds appear very nice and consistent, which is nice sign. The flanges that bolt the collector to the head are nice and stout. The contact point that touches the head is machined, not just some saw cut pipe. The bends in the head pipes are very nice and sweeping, no kinks, etc. The collector appears to be pretty nice as well. Metal thickness measures right around .045".
The only things that looked low quality were the finish, which appear to be standard el cheapo high temp paint. I was expecting this and am ok with it. After I have it modified I'll likely have it ceramic coated.
The other cheap appearing item is that the baffle appears to be sealed and held in place with bead of caulk or adhesive. I was likely going to make a slight different baffle anyway as this one is 1 1/8" id, so I'll make something a little better than caulk. Again, not a big deal.
As for seeing if it fits, that may have to wait a bit. It was 2 degrees this morning, so the garage is too cold work in. Hopefully the fit is decent.
if the fit is decent, I'll weld in an o2 bung for tuning, and maybe some ports for EGT sensors.
I wont' know how it sounds until spring.
